In the play/film 'Sabrina Fair' the other characters are David and Linus.

As it is a Latinised name, how about other Latin names eg Felix, Benedict, Anthony, Mark, Marcus, Adrian, Miles, Myles, Dominic, Francis, Gregory,Julian, Leo, Luke, Lucian, Sebastian, Maximillian?

Some of those are a bit OTT, although not unknown, but others are good, classic, not over popular choices.
